About This Item
McClelland & Stewart, Toronto,, 1963. First Edition. Hardcover. Good/Good/Fair. this copy has a tight binding with clean unmarked text...previous owners inscription of the FFEP and his name on the back of the front cover...the dust jacket has much wear...encased in a protective mylar sleeve.....
